site stats

Scala map foreach 区别

WebDec 22, 2011 · m.foreach(p => println(">>> key=" + p._1 + ", value=" + p._2)) That is, foreach takes a function that takes a pair and returns Unit, not a function that takes two … WebJan 25, 2024 · foreach. 对集合中元素进行某种操作,但是返回值为空,实际上相当于for循环的一个简写版。. 这个看上去比较绕,本来我以为是可以对元素进行某种更改呢,后来发现是理解错误的。. scala> s. foreach ( f => println (f) ) hello world scala> s. foreach ( f => f. concat ( "test") ) scala ...

Scala Map foreach - Stack Overflow

WebScala map和foreach的区别 theme: vuepress 数组中forEach和map的区别 forEach和map的相同点 相同点: 都是循环遍历数组的每一项 forEach和map方法里每次执行匿名函数都 … WebAug 7, 2015 · Scala中的集合对象都有foreach和map两个方法。. 两个方法的共同点在于:都是用于遍历集合对象,并对每一项执行指定的方法。. 而两者的差异在于:foreach无返回 … tarik bugra https://epsghomeoffers.com

scala—向量(Vector) - 知乎 - 知乎专栏

WebNov 16, 2016 · Scala中的map与collect. 在Scala中,当我需要对集合的元素进行转换时,自然而然会使用到 map 方法。. 而当我们在对tuple类型的集合或者针对Map进行map操作时,通常更倾向于在 map 方法中使用case语句,这比直接使用 _1 与 _2 更加可读。. 例如:. 效果完全相同。. 我很少 ... http://geekdaxue.co/read/polarisdu@interview/bduh7f WebAug 13, 2024 · Practice. Video. The foreach () method is utilized to apply the given function to all the elements of the map. Method Definition: def foreach (f: ( (A, B)) => Unit): Unit. Return Type: It returns all the elements of the map … tarik caa

Scala中的Map_51CTO博客_scala中的map函数

Category:Scala系列7:函数式编程之foreach,forall的使用详解 - CSDN …

Tags:Scala map foreach 区别

Scala map foreach 区别

Scala 中的 foreach 循环 D栈 - Delft Stack

WebFeb 26, 2024 · 最近有不少同学问我,Spark 中 foreachRDD、foreachPartition和foreach 的区别,工作中经常会用错或不知道怎么用,今天简单聊聊它们之间的区别:其实区别它们很 … Web因为 map & forEach 的主要区别是有无返回,所以,当你想基于一个原数组返回一个新数组,可以选择 map,当你只是想遍历数据不需要考虑返回时可以选择 forEach。

Scala map foreach 区别

Did you know?

WebMar 13, 2024 · 1. forEach是数组的一个方法,for循环是js的基本语法之一。. 2. forEach方法需要传入一个回调函数作为参数,而for循环不需要。. 3. forEach方法会自动遍历数组中的每一个元素,并将其作为回调函数的参数传入,而for循环需要手动指定数组的下标来访问每一 … Web47 rows · Scala Map(映射) Scala 集合. Map(映射)是一种可迭代的键值对(key/value)结构。 所有的值都可以通过键来获取。 Map 中的键都是唯一的。 Map 也叫哈希表(Hash …

WebforEach (): 针对每一个元素执行提供的函数 (executes a provided function once for each array element)。. map (): 创建一个新的数组,其中每一个元素由调用数组中的每一个元素 … http://geekdaxue.co/read/polarisdu@interview/krgnue

WebJan 24, 2024 · Scala常规操作之数组、List、Tuple、Set、Map,本文会进行数组、List、元组的实操数组可以是val类型,但是数据里面的具体值也是可以变的,但其实数组本身是没有变的。一、数组1、创建数组有两种方式:第一种,new出来valarr=newArray[String](3)arr(0)="hello"第二种,直接赋值vala=Array("nihao","hello","hi")2 … WebMay 31, 2024 · 关于scala中的map基础详解. Scala提供了一套很好的集合实现,提供了一些集合类型的抽象。. Scala 集合分为可变的和不可变的集合。. 可变集合可以在适当的地方被更新或扩展。. 这意味着你可以修改,添加,移除一个集合的元素。. 而不可变集合类,相比之下 ...

WebScala Map foreach ()用法及代码示例. foreach ()方法用于将给定函数应用于Map的所有元素。. 函数定义: def foreach (f: ( (A, B)) => Unit): Unit. 返回类型: It returns all the elements …

WebNov 22, 2024 · JavaScript 有一些方便的方法可以帮助我们遍历数组。最常用于迭代的两个是 Array.prototype.map() 和 Array.prototype.forEach()。 但我认为它们仍然有点不清楚,特别是对于初学者来说。因为它们都进行了迭代并输出了一些东西。那么区别是什么呢? 在本文中,我们将研究以下内容: * 定义 * 返回值 * 是否能够 ... tarik cacanWebMar 13, 2024 · 在Java中,stream.map和stream.foreach都是用于处理集合中的元素的方法,但它们有一些区别。. stream.map方法会将集合中的每个元素都映射到一个新的元素上,然后返回一个新的集合。. 而stream.foreach方法则是对集合中的每个元素进行操作,但不会返回任何结果。. 它通常 ... tarik cafe餌 赤タン 作り方http://duoduokou.com/scala/37795665027525735208.html tarik campbellWebforeach(Partition) )和异步( foreach(Partition)Async )提交之间的选择以及元素访问和分区访问之间的选择都不会影响执行顺序。在第一种情况下,阻塞执行与非阻塞执行的重要区别在于,在第二种情况下,数据的公开方式与实际执行机制大致相同 tarik camdalWebFind local businesses, view maps and get driving directions in Google Maps. tarik cantorWebApr 11, 2024 · forEach方法,是最基本的方法,就是遍历与循环,默认有3个传参:分别是遍历的数组内容item、数组索引index、和当前遍历数组Array; map方法,基本用法与forEach一致,但是不同的,它会返回一个新的数组,所以在callback需要有return值,如果没有,会返 … 餌 量 メダカ